柯林斯词典
- N-VAR 学徒身份;学徒期
Someone who has anapprenticeshipworks for a fixed period of time for a person who has a particular skill in order to learn the skill.Apprenticeshipis the system of learning a skill like this.- After serving his apprenticeship as a toolmaker, he became a manager.
结束了工具匠的学徒期以后,他当上了经理。 - ...a period of apprenticeship.
